Silver Britannia: Power of British Craft
One of the first things that needs to be said about Britannia is that it is minted by the Royal Mint, meaning it’s more than a digital representation of value. It’s British history and craftsmanship, a piece showcasing the resilience and power of Lady Britannia that has long been a symbol of the invincibility of the British army.
It appeals to investors because:
- It has a metal purity of.999, or 99.9%.
- It has the status of UK-legal tender, which means it’s exempt from Capital Gains Tax.
- It has one of the highest levels of micro-detailing and has one of the best security arrangements in the industry, so counterfeiting it is virtually impossible.

Maple Silver Leaf: Towards Purity
Silver Maple leaf keeps dominating the bullion market outside of the United Kingdom. Minted by the Royal Canadian Mint, it grew into a globally recognized piece of value known for precision and new approaches to anti-counterfeiting:
- It contains.9999, or 99.99% of pure silver, one of the highest figures in the world.
- It is protected by advanced identification systems, including radial lines and laser-engraved coin details.
- It boasts a design universally acknowledged for identification, meaning it can be sold easily in nearly every major market.

Silver Britannia vs Maple: Behind the Coin
The Silver Britannia vs Maple comparison isn’t about the height of production or experimental design. It’s about purpose.
- Choose Britannia if you’re buying for tax benefits, history, and a local brand.
- Choose Maple if you want purity, technology, and a worldwide reputation.
